    Ron, I have the same boat but one Racor 1000 on each 4-53. The Detroits
    have a much larger fuel circulation than most diesels because they use the
    fuel to cool the injectors. We both need to know if this flow is enough so
    that we do not need an entire new circulating system, but can instead put a
    Gulf Coast or equivalent in line with the current system.
    I am thinking of getting a Dual Racor 1000 for each.
    Does anyone know how much a 4-53 Detroit circulates in a hour?
